NetApp has secured its position as a Leader in Gartner’s 2026 Magic Quadrant for Enterprise Storage Platforms, a distinction reaffirming its strong hybrid cloud strategy and execution.

In the recently released Magic Quadrant for Enterprise Storage Platforms, Gartner rated NetApp highest in the Hybrid Cloud Storage use case and second for Hybrid Platform Services, reflecting its continued strength in delivering unified storage across on‑premises and cloud environments. The report furthers NetApp’s position from the inaugural 2025 edition. Analysts cited its NetApp Platform—an intelligent data infrastructure designed to enable zero‑copy data access and serve AI and analytics workloads efficiently across hybrid and multicloud environments—as a key differentiator.

This recognition underscores NetApp’s strategic focus on enabling enterprises to manage, protect, and activate data consistently across clouds. Gartner’s high marks for both vision and execution speak to the maturity of NetApp’s offerings and its alignment with evolving enterprise storage needs.

Context and Next Steps

This announcement arrives following NetApp’s acquisition of JetStream Software on August 6, which expanded its capabilities in cyber resilience and VMware integration—further supporting its hybrid cloud and AI positioning. The Gartner recognition reinforces the strategic coherence of recent acquisitions and product investments.
